Software Developer

Sigao

Software Developer

Birmingham, AL
Full Time
Paid
  • Responsibilities

    Summary

    ****We are looking for talented, passionate developers in the greater Birmingham, Alabama area, to join our technology consulting startup. This is an early-mid level position that will be an active member of an Agile team building software and solving problems for a variety of customers. Our teams are self-directed and work closely with our clients to deliver business critical applications for a variety of industries including healthcare, finance, banking, e-government and others. Team members should care about creating great code, interacting with a wide array of industries and customers, and collaborating with a team of problem-solving experts.

    What makes Sigao different?

    ****Our mission is to make our team members and customers better than before they met us.

    This means our primary purpose is to support the people around us. We do that by building an environment where people can learn new skills, collaborate effectively, and solve problems using technology. Sigao may be growing, but we don't pursue "rocket ship" growth at the expense of our team's sanity. Instead, our focus is on sustainable long-term growth and stability.

    As part of a startup team, you'll have the opportunity to grow with an early-stage company. Those who are along for the ride will have the opportunity to help shape what kind of company we turn into.

    What makes this position different from others?

    ****This role involves more communication than some development positions. We attribute our extremely high project success rate and customer satisfaction to our team's ability to communicate effectively with each other, and our customers. All developers are full members of the team that contribute quality code, interact with customers, and provide insight on project deliverables.

    In addition to strong communication, our developers are encouraged to be creative. Finding the right solution could mean writing custom code, implementing 3rd party tools, or integrating some combination of the two. Our goal is to solve problems as effectively as possible, and no two solutions look the same.

    What kind of technology do we use?

    ****Our team prides itself in being technology agnostic. We use whatever technology is most suited to the individual customer's situation. Expect a lot of learning in a lot of different areas!

    With that said, we've listed our core strengths below. These technologies are our strongest, and what we prefer to use when we have the choice. While we don't expect every new team member to know this stack before they join us, we do expect for them to be able to build their expertise in these areas quickly.

    • Methodology: Agile/Scrum
    • Source control: Azure Devops/git
    • Middle Tier: .NET Core/C#
    • Web Front end: Angular or React (and by extension, HTML/CSS/JS)
    • Mobile: Ionic or Nativescript
    • Cloud services: Azure
    • Low Code: Microsoft Dynamics 365, Power Platform (Power Automate, Power BI, etc)

    What about benefits?

    • ****Health Insurance
    • Dental Insurance
    • Unlimited PTO
    • 401k match (100% up to 3%)
    • Hybrid (flex schedule)
    • Dog friendly office

    To sum it up, we're looking for someone who...

    • Has a degree in Computer Science or related field or comparable relevant experience
    • Has 0-5 years professional experience
    • Has some experience with the technologies in our stack
    • Likes learning
    • Is looking forward to actively contributing to the life and growth of Sigao
    • Is comfortable communicating technical concepts both with other engineers and with non-technical stakeholders
    • Likes solving problems and helping people
    • Likes (or at least is ok with) dogs
    • Is legally qualified to work in the United States ( We do not sponsor visas at this time.)